Overview

Lake View Terrace is a suburban neighborhood in Los Angeles with a median home price of $1,127,150 and average rent of $3,756. The housing stock is dominated by older, well-established single-family homes built mostly between 1940 and 1969.

Families find this neighborhood appealing due to top public schools, low crime, and a strong owner-occupied housing presence. The community has a notable Armenian and Croatian ancestry population and a high rate of executive and professional occupations.

Housing market and real estate character

Lake View Terrace's housing market is characterized by a dominance of older, detached single-family homes with a balanced mix of owners and renters.

Commute

Most residents drive alone to work, with a significant portion facing longer commutes between 45 minutes and one hour.

Lake View Terrace residents typically have longer commutes and rely heavily on private vehicles.

High Drive Alone Rate — Nearly 80% of workers drive alone, reflecting car dependency.
Long Commute Times — Over one-third of commuters spend 45 to 60 minutes traveling to work.
